Mahabharata Udyoga Parva – ततः कषीणे हयानीके किं चिच छेषे च भारत

Shloka (श्लोक)
ततः कषीणे हयानीके किं चिच छेषे च भारत
सौबलस्यात्मजाः शूरा निर्गता रणमूर्धनि
⚡ Quick Meaning
This shloka conveys a sense of loss and departure of warriors.
Translations
English Translation
It depicts the diminished army of horsemen and how the brave sons of Subala emerge on the battlefield, calling attention to the change in the tide of the war.
